With ADP's Millennia Series, dealers can take full advantage of one of the most powerful microprocessing technologies in the industry today on a hardware platform that accepts, processes and produces date-based information accurately and reliably beyond 1999. ADP's 8800 and 88110 product line has evolved into the Millennia2 Series and will continue to provide the efficient and reliable file management capabilities ADP customers have grown to expect. The modular Millennia3 Series includes the high-performance Series 9200 and Series 9300 server systems. The Series 9200 scales from eight to 350 users in a single platform, while the Series 9300 accommodates between 350 to 1,700 users.
